不管你是待业还是失业,在这个被互联网围绕的时代里,选择学python人工智能好不好学,就多了一项技能,还怕找不到工作?,还怕不好找工作?小编就来告诉你这个专业的优势到底体现在哪里:Python好学吗?将来能有什么前途?,为什么我不建议你通过 Python 去找工作?,年少无知的我也被python课程割了韭菜!分享被割全过程!,普通人学Python有什么用???。
1.Python好学吗?将来能有什么前途?
python相比于其他编程语言来说,好学!python将来最有用的前途主要是来源于人工智能!先说python好不好学?可以明确的来说,python很好学,如果你现在正在从事其他语言开发,那么你学习python可以说都不用太刻意下功夫,平时多看看,可能就会应用了。如果是零基础的话,也不会太难的,推荐你看一个python的基础视频,python入门教程(懂中文就能学会)!可以看下学习之后学生的评价,这个教程里面有一个飞机大战的小项目,能更好的让你融入到python的知识。顺便来一张python的学习路线图!
2.为什么我不建议你通过 Python 去找工作?
二哥,你好,我是一名大专生,学校把 Python 做为主语言教给我们,但是我也去了解过,其实 Python 门槛挺高的,所以我在自学 Java,但是我现在并不清楚到底要不要全心的去学 Java,学校里的课程也越来越繁重,而学 Java 又会要投入很多精力,我很纠结疑惑。希望二哥可以给一点建议。二哥看到的话还望百忙之中抽一点时间。感谢! 这是读者“前进一点”在微信上问我的一个问题,我当时给他的回复是“Python 挺火的,学 Python 就好。”但当我在 B 站上看了羊哥的一期视频后,深感懊悔,觉得自己给出的建议是不负责任的。意识到自己的问题之后,我就赶紧给读者“前进一点”发了一条信息道歉。另外,回想起之前还有一些读者问过我类似的问题,我的答案都不够严谨,因此打算特意写一篇文章来反省一下。羊哥视频里面分享的内容还是非常严谨的,他认为,Python 应用的方向主要有 5 个方面:人工智能和机器学习数据分析爬虫Web 开发自动化测试有理有据,所以我完全认同羊哥的观点。01、人工智能和机器学习人工智能和机器学习是 Python 应用的重头戏,但这方面的岗位对学历的要求非常高,高到我自己都应聘不上,非常残酷。在招聘网站上大致浏览了一下,我发现,这方面的岗位不算多,但工资挺给力的,在 15K- 30K。不过,招聘信息上直接说了,“我们的程序员小伙伴都毕业于 211/985 学校”,就这一条,我就会被拒之门外。学历硬伤啊,所以应聘“人工智能和机器学习”这方面的岗位很难,扎心,谁叫咱不是学霸呢。考虑到我的读者已经蔓延到了*生群体,我得郑重其事地说一句,“如果你喜欢学习,那就好好学,别在该学习的年纪浪费了青春。”哎呀,我去,说这句话真有点拿自己做反面教材的感觉。我上*的时候,一直是*名,因为学校的招生范围就我们村那么大,一共也就三四十名学生。等到上了*,一直保持前四,因为学校的招生范围就我们乡那么大,一共也就三四百名学生。等到上了高中,一直保持学校,但在整个县城是没有任何优势的。真的是天外有天,人外有人,大部分人都是平凡的,普通的,所以这方面的岗位竞争真的很难。02、数据分析一般的小公司,比如说我就职过的公司,完全就没有数据分析的必要性,因为重点是在产品上,如何做好产品吸引来用户才是重点。如果说产品的用户数量少,数据就完全发挥不出价值。那也就意味着,数据分析工程师的岗位会相对较少,毕竟有大数据的公司屈指可数。但说实话,这个岗位的薪资还是非常给力的,发展前景也好。如果学习能力强的话,硬指标过关的话,可以尝试。工资高,通常的原因是供不应求,也就是说岗位多,但人才少。但实际情况是,数据分析的岗位少,符合要求的人才更少。在公司只是在重复操作 SQL、Excel 等基础工具的数据分析员很容易被自动化工具替代,又扎心了。大专院校把 Python 作为主语言来教的话,我想肯定不是奔着这两个方向(人工智能、机器学习和数据分析)来的。*个原因就是学历的问题,第二个原因就是教师不一定能教得会,更别说学生能不能学会了。03、爬虫关于爬虫,不得不提一下羊哥视频评论区的一句话,不管是不是段子,我觉得挺值得深思的。 我有个同学搞爬虫被带走了,还好他不是主犯,就是登记了一下。 爬虫是近些年非常火热的一个话题,连我都买了一本爬虫入门的书,准备学一学,无奈 Java 方面可写的素材越来越多,这个计划一直未能成行。什么是爬虫呢?可能有些不是程序员的读者不太清楚,我找百科问了问,它说,“爬虫,又称网页蜘蛛,是一种按照一定规则,自动抓取互联网信息的程序或者脚本。”在知识付费的大环境下,这种爬虫就有点麻烦。拿我来说吧,我希望自己的文章只发表在我希望发表的平台下,假如其他平台在未经我的授权下,就把我的文章爬走,放在自家平台上,我就觉得知识产权受到了破坏。文章还好,是我愿意公开的,如果涉及到一些隐私信息被爬取,那就更糟糕了,是吧?现在很多平台都在做反爬,并且做得越来越好,这就在一定程度上有点“魔高一尺道高一丈”的意味,所以,爬虫方面的工程师还是蛮不容易的。04、Web 开发用 Python 做 Web 开发的大型互联网公司我听说的不多,羊哥说豆瓣以前用的是 Python,现在也不用了。不管怎么说,如果拿 Java 来和 Python 相比的话,显然在 Web 开发方面的优势巨大。不管是从技术框架上,还是性能上,以及应用的规模上,同等条件下,Java 工程师显然更吃香啊。很多培训机构夸赞 Python 在 Web 开发方面有着巨大的优势,开发效率高,速度快。嗯,其实我觉得应该是因为 Python 的语法简单,容易教——这恐怕是主要原因啊,我这样说会不会被社会毒打?这样吧,我给小伙伴推荐一个网址: Django 的,一个广受欢迎且功能完整的服务器端网站框架,Python 写的,并且是 MDN 出品,最重要的是,免费的。05、自动化测试说句实在话,Python 的自动化测试还是应用非常广泛的,考虑到框架的脚本质量,测试用例的简单性,以及运行模块可能存在的技术弱点,我给大家推荐五款 Python 的测试框架。1)Robot Framework,主要用于测试驱动类型的开发与验收中。2)Pytest,特点是开源、易学。3)PyUnit,针对单元测试的 Python 类自动化测试框架,收到 Junit 的启发。4)Behave,允许团队执行 BDD(行为驱动开发,behavior-driven ) 测试。5)Lettuce,专注于具有行为驱动开发特征的普通任务。06、*以上观点都是我个人主观给出的,不一定正确哈,仅做参考。如果说,有些读者的学历非常牛逼,然后学习能力也非常强,那么选择人工智能、机器学习、数据分析,我觉得前途是光明的,既能赚钱,待遇又好,还不可替代,不学 Python 绝对亏。如果说,有些读者学历一般,做程序员仅仅是为了糊口饭吃,那么我觉得可以把 Python 作为第二语言来学,不要当做主语言。搞点范围许可内的爬虫,自动化测试,我就觉得挺好的。况且 Python 这门语言本身是非常优秀的,不然怎么搞人工智能,海量数据分析,对吧?如果觉得文章对你有点帮助,请微信搜索「 沉默王二 」*时间阅读。 本文已收录 GitHub,传送门~ ,里面更有大厂面试完整考点,欢迎 Star。 我是沉默王二,一枚有颜值却靠才华苟且的程序员。关注即可提升学习效率,别忘了三连啊,点赞、收藏、留言,我不挑,嘻嘻。
3.年少无知的我也被python课程割了韭菜!分享被割全过程!
作为一个互联网从业者,最近总能看到铺天盖地的python广告。“不用本地安装,大牛老师带领入门,零基础入门”,好嘛,话都被他说完了,让我们这些悬梁刺股的编程人怎么想。大半夜的我坐在床上和满屏的广告面面相觑。我看了看微信余额,决定奉献出钱包里的0.01,看看这个神神叨叨的课程到底是怎么让我“零基础”快速学会python的。 这个对Python的解释让我成功笑出了声,这是谁家的老师这么皮?学过C++的我默默拿起了刀。目前看下来这个课还是很人性化的,零基础的小白可以试一下,市面上python入门*的课程之一,就是风变科技的python小课,以前叫熊猫小课,微信上非常火,他们公众号有8.9元体验课程,别着急去微信。618的隐藏活动,让我找出来了,体验课只要1分钱,0.01元吃不了亏上不了当,戳一下你自己可以试试看 接下来就是手把手教学的函数环节,逐步讲解,配合实际操作,非常易懂。虽然我知道他一定会正确运行,但是游戏闯关的设计模式,真的很有成就感。课程中间还会穿插课后习题,做错的话会给出正确答案和解析,看起来这个课程比你自己更害怕你学不会。后面的课程大同小异,为了节省时间我统统选择了正确答案。完成了整节课程之后,还有张思维导图给你,很简单清晰,直接截图保存,非常方便随时复习。一节课下来,我回忆了一下,脑海中的知识结构还是很清晰的,和我之前学的晦涩难懂的编程课程有所区别,对于什么都不懂的小白来说,是非常合适的入门课程。手把手一点点教学的节奏,也不会让人很有安全感,没有担心跟不上节奏的窘迫。当然,时间有限,毕竟是朝九晚不知道几点的社畜,*节之后我就结束了学习。不过这个课程可以随时暂停,而且助教老师随时都在,只要有时间,随时可以登录网站学一学,每天20分钟就能有很大的收获。虽然付出了0.01元,但我觉得这次,我没有被割韭菜。这个课程能看出是用心做的,起码对的起这个价格,有兴趣的可以点击试试。 比如:喝杯咖啡的时间,产品销售情况就可以整齐的自动汇总在Excel表格里,如果你的工作每天都需要处理大量的表格信息的话,学一学python能让你进入全新的领域。课后助教除了给我很多的电子资料礼包外,还有很多思维导图,还有一本python学习手册,我放图给你们看看,资料质量还是不错的。函数的导图函数的导图基础知识导图基础知识导图错误异常导图错误异常导图总结一下吧,事实证明一个靠谱的Python基础入门课程还是很有用的,能够在没人带领的情况下让一个毫无基础的小白轻松入门。起码我上的这个课设计的还是挺合理,闯关着学习,还能领取非常系统的学习资料,有东西拿到手的感觉还不错,起码不会觉得自己被割了韭菜(但是这些对我来说没用啊,所以我好像还是亏了),你们可以点击领取。
4.普通人学Python有什么用?
同在公司同一岗位的两个人,老板需要过往一年的数据进行复盘分析,不懂的只能按照以前整理的慢慢来,更多可能没整理需要自己去慢慢一格格的看,然后用表格写一大堆数据然后自己分析,两三天是肯定的。懂python的直接抓取数据生成表格,两个小时就完事。并且有条理更详细。所以python除了程序员这一大受众,也会有其他行业的人加入进来,基数大当然学的也大,当然也是有很多人把python当做工作,不知道题主是玩玩还是啥,就在更下面细说吧。更多人学python并不是为了靠这个养活自己,而是利用python加强自身本职工作的竞争力。比如新媒体,产品经理、财务、证券等。毕竟python好处看得到,也是学起来最简单的编程语言。比如新媒体职业:1、简单来说,你会python后就相当于自己建造一个属于自己工作区块的微博热搜榜。你可以利用爬虫、收据抓取等技术知道哪些话题近期特别火,为什么火、有什么共通点,然后根据这些依据来进行自己文章的撰写,在找idea上也花不了那么多时间。2、写作过程中,也能在网上抓取相应文章、数据、以及原始素材,形成自己的数据库,基本你确定一个想写的文章架构,后续的内容填充,事件举例就是很简单的事情了。只要自己想法足够好,就能出一篇爆款。3、另外有帮助的就是文章质量,你真的挖掘出热点高频词汇,哪些句式和故事被引用最多,也能分析其他的头条号、公众号等等,看看人们最喜欢看的都是些啥,最近词汇在人们搜索中所占比重,别人都是跟在热点屁股上,你就是蹭热点脸上。4、有数据支撑也会让你头脑更清醒,也不会有什么流量大起大落还不明白的地方,所有流程都是属于透明的。你还可以进行脚本制作,帮助你更好的管理你所做的运营。对于程序员来说还有一部分人学是因为python在程序员中很多时候相当于一个胶水的存在,帮助更好的完成你的编程工作,并且你单独学python其实也是为即将到来的人工智能做铺垫。毕竟人工智能大多都是由python写的。大多牛逼的程序员不可能只会一种语言。python的确是后来居上的语言,也很有用,虽然现在主流是java,但python是趋势这句话也没有错。另外网上说学python更多是想要入这一行的,因为python比较简单,选最简单的入行肯定没错,只不过现在只会python工作不好找。但真的有本事,真的也不愁。这东西就是因人而异,有些人学了不会灵活运用,自然没有,有些人就能把他当做ps一样,给自己工作增添很多优秀案例。免责声明:内容图片均来源于网络, 版权归原作者所有如有侵权请立即与我们联系,我们将及时删除处理
就拿大数据说话,优势一目了然,从事IT行业,打开IT行业的新大门,找到适合自己的培训机构,进行专业和系统的学习。